Hey guys I think I want to include a caster in my Warherd... if not I will add another Doombull. Can you leave me some suggestions?

Here's what I have so far... need this to be 1000 points

Hero- Doombull
Battleline - 3x Bullgors (great axes), 3x Bullgor (Axes and shields)
Behemoths - Ghorgon x2

I have 120 points to play with. I like the Gaunt Summor of Tzeentch but I'm guessing its not legal. Only option Bray Shaman?

Thanks!

Since you need to maintain Warherd alliance to keep your Bullgors battleline, the Bray Shaman is going to be your only option if you want to add a wizard to your army. Savage Dominion could get one of your ghorgons into the enemy's back field, but without anything to buff your casting its kind of a dangerous risk to take. Also worth noting, while the Great Bray Shaman's passive ability cant effect any of the Warherd in your army, it can at least effect itself, making it a effectively speedy wizard or extra mobile character for garbing those certain objectives.
